Sleep

Using transition components without exterior public libraries

.vue2-transitions.The shifts elements Vue 2 Shifts for Vue.js allows you to generate switches in a variety of techniques, utilizing this configurable compilation. Each shift element has ~ 2kb (non-minified js+ css or even ~ 400 bytes gzipped) as well as you can import only the ones you definitely need to have.Trial Webpage.A lot of alternate options import the entire animate.css public library. Vue2-transitions is actually minimalistic and lets you import only the transitions that you need to have in your application.Code Sand Box Instance.List of accessible transitions.FadeTransition.ZoomCenterTransition.ZoomXTransition.ZoomYTransition.ZoomUpTransition.CollapseTransition.ScaleTransition.SlideXLeftTransition.SlideXRightTransition.SlideXUpTransition.SlideXDownTransition.Props.props: / **.* Change timeframe. Number for defining the same period for enter/leave switches.* Object type get into: 300, leave: 300 for indicating specific durations for enter/leave.*/.timeframe: style: [Number, Things],.nonpayment: 300.,./ **.* Whether the part needs to be actually a 'transition-group' component.*/.group: Boolean,./ **.* Improve roots property https://tympanus.net/codrops/css_reference/transform-origin/.* Could be specified with styles also yet it's much shorter through this prop.*/.origin: type: Cord,.nonpayment:".,./ **.* Factor designs that are applied in the course of transition. These types are actually administered on @beforeEnter as well as @beforeLeave hooks.*/.designs: kind: Object,.nonpayment: () =&gt return animationFillMode: 'both',.animationTimingFunction: 'ease-out'.Group changes.Each change can be used as a transition-group by incorporating the group prop to one of the preferred transitions.
Gotchas/things to watch:.Aspects inside group changes should have show: inline-block or should be actually put in a flex context:.Vue.js doctors reference.Each transition has an action course relocation course docs.Unfortunately, the timeframe of the move shift can easily not be configured via props. Through default each change has a relocation course affiliated.with.3 s shift timeframe:.Zoom. zoom-move shift: improve.3 s ease-out.Slide. slide-move change: enhance.3 s ease-out.Scale. scale-move shift: enhance.3 s cubic-bezier(.25,.8,.50,1).Vanish. fade-move switch: change.3 s ease-out.If you wish to set up the timeframe, merely redefine the lesson for the change you utilize along with the desired period.Instance.To start teaming up with the Vue Swiper utilize the observing demand( s) to install it.npm i vue2-transitions.yarn include vue2-transitions.in a Webpack create.bring in Vue coming from 'vue'.bring in Shifts coming from 'vue2-transitions'.Vue.use( Changes).Usage:.Utilize the part anywhere you will like in the design template:.
Your transition.
The above profit is an instance of a ScaleTransition.That's it! If you would like to begin along with Vue Transitions, head to the task's storehouse on GitHub, where you will likewise discover the resource code.

Articles You Can Be Interested In